The Job You'll Do:
- Responding to client enquiries, tendering activity, and close collaboration with engineering and manufacturing teams.
- Account management of existing customers, ensuring their requirements are met and new project opportunities are identified.
- Responding promptly and professionally to all incoming enquiries.
- Providing accurate product information and guidance to customers.
- Preparing and issuing customer quotations with a high degree of accuracy.
- Liaising with existing customers and supporting order activities.
- Processing customer orders, deliveries, and queries.
- Working closely with engineering, operations, and senior management.
- Representing the business professionally at customer meetings.

About You:
- Proven experience within a Technical Sales/Sales Engineer role.
- Relevant technical qualifications (Degree, HNC, NVQ etc.) are desirable but not essential.
- Experience liaising with Engineering teams (Projects, Design etc.).
- Strong written communication skills, with the ability to compose clear and professional emails and quotations.
- Excellent attention to detail and a high level of accuracy.
- Strong organisational skills, with the ability to prioritise workload effectively.
- A proactive approach with the ability to use initiative.
- Good working knowledge of Microsoft Word and Excel.
- Comfortable speaking with customers as well as managing internally.
- Excellent communication and relationship-building ability.
